Output 951807c2aeeab2cc266e07a2abe1375eb7d3c3bb9273956375462f7561e0e33b:26

value
795076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1436a85d3a8c81793489e659aabd1206672a9c OP_EQUAL
address
34ACPBXH6P4WTA5UUFzECCFZ1CiFK7FL9W
transaction
951807c2aeeab2cc266e07a2abe1375eb7d3c3bb9273956375462f7561e0e33b
spent
true